Output 68f1b017e6c486f88a438c864e2b8575b87de29b76e160d8d0deed405717349e:5

value
3646448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01646309918af57db50cc717c8b31a9aa3f211b5 OP_EQUALVERIFY OP_CHECKSIG
address
18MwCDr1RQipxhHcyueMoEgcXAiLesToL
transaction
68f1b017e6c486f88a438c864e2b8575b87de29b76e160d8d0deed405717349e
spent
true